Manchester United will visit China in the summer

Manchester United have announced plans to travel to China as part of their pre-season preparations for the 2016-17 campaign.

United will spend eight days in the country and play two matches with details for the rest of their summer plans to be announced in due course.

There has been speculation United could play neighbours City, who are also visiting China to play in the International Champions Cup tournament, but opponents and dates for the games have not yet been confirmed.

United's executive vice-chairman Ed Woodward said: "Manchester United have strong historical links with China and we are very proud of our relationship and of our fans throughout the country.

"A total of almost 500,000 supporters have attended previous games during our visits to China and we have always enjoyed exceptional support in the country, so naturally it is something that everybody is very much looking forward to this summer."

United estimate they have more than 107m followers in China.

They first toured the country in 1975 and have made nine further visits since.
